1) Which sentence is correct? a) She has been study English all morning. b) She has been studying English all morning. 2) What have they been doing? a) They have been playing football. b) They has been play football. 3) Which sentence is correct? a) I have been studying for three hours. b) I have been study for three hours 4) Have you been studying English for a long time? a) Yes, I have been studying English for three years. b) Yes, I study English yesterday. 5) Has she been working on the project since Monday? a) Yes, she worked on it tomorrow. b) Yes, she has been working on it all week. 6) Which sentence is correct? a) They have been playing football all afternoon b) They has been playing football all afternoon.
